so you can recharge your batteries.

It means the speaker is offering a ride home so the other person can rest and recover their energy.

When do people say this?

Scene Context

Someone offers to take the other person home so they can rest.

Usage Scenario

Use this when you want to sound caring and practical, especially after someone is tired or overwhelmed. 'Recharge your batteries' is common and natural, but a bit figurative.

Better ways to say it

1
I'll take you home so you can rest.
2
Let me take you home and recharge.
3
I'll drive you home so you can rest up.
